Eric Hess of Penn high school has given his verbal commitment to play for Kellogg Community College. The 6-foot-1, 175-pound Hess demonstrates a strong arm (77 mph from the crouch) along with quick feet and transfer… An accurate thrower, his 1.97 pop time was the best at one of the PBRs winter event. Hess was also one of the top 5 hitters at the event, as he showcased the ability to drive the ball to all fields with some pop. Hess is considered a premium catch and throw prospect with above average athleticism and speed for a catcher. At Kellogg he will become battery mates with another former Indiana Chargers player, Nic Mishler. |
